Intelligent business automation combines physical infrastructure with digital control. Think lighting, audio/visual systems, HVAC, and security, all connected to a central dashboard. You can control everything from one place, automate schedules, and monitor usage in real time. Whether you manage an office, warehouse, or client-facing space, the benefits show up quickly.
Start with lighting. Motion sensors and occupancy-based lighting schedules reduce waste and keep costs down. Add integrated HVAC control, and you’ll save energy and extend the life of your systems. Layer in AV automation for meeting rooms or retail spaces, and the experience will become seamless for staff and clients.
But automation isn’t just about convenience. It’s also about safety. When integrated with surveillance and access control, you can automate lights after-hours, trigger alerts for unusual movement, or even remotely grant access to deliveries or contractors.
